The mission of this program is to support the women of Uganda who face abuse, neglect and gender injustices on a daily basis. Mission Trips Uganda and their partner in Uganda place volunteers into various community locations such as orphanages, schools, Women's Centers and Groups with the aim of providing support, skills and resources to empower the women towards a better life. Opportunities exist for qualified and experienced volunteers to work with women who have suffered abuse, while business minded volunteers can assist with entrepreneurial enterprises. Volunteers with a passion to assist without formal qualifications will find valuable roles with younger children. By necessity the program is flexible around schooling, work and family commitments.

What the Mission Trip Will Be Like

Goals of this Project:

  • Provide essential care and support to vulnerable young women
  • Improve the future prospects of abused and disadvantaged women through education and skills
  • Give vulnerable women quality care, compassion and a sense of hope
  • Enable inter-cultural exchange which benefits both locals and international volunteers alike.

How You Can Help:

Volunteers on this program play an essential role in helping women, young and old, escape from the cycle of violence and ingrained gender abuses prevalent in Uganda. Participants will spend their time supporting women and assisting the local staff as needed. Volunteers can be involved in a variety of roles dependent on their skills and preferences including education, vocational training (such as tailoring, hairdressing, gardening, cooking, Basket making, cleaning etc), business and life skills.Those trained  in counselling, psychology or psychiatry can work in their area of expertise to help abused women recover from traumatic past events. This is a challenging but hugely rewarding placement for any volunteer.

Volunteers will contribute in a number of ways on this program and can expect to undertake the following tasks:

  • Support women in a number of ways
  • Provide education on a variety of topics
  • Organize activities and provide skill-based training
  • Work on awareness raising initiatives

 

Requirements: 18yo+

Mission Trips Uganda welcomes all those 18 years and over who wish to help us provide support to some of Uganda's most marginalized and vulnerable women. While this challenging project does not require participants to have a background in the fields of social work, counselling and/or Women’s studies, as there are many ways you can assist, volunteers with suitable education, qualifications or experience are highly sought after. Regardless, a volunteer’s individual role can often be tailored to suit their particular skills and interests. All applicants must of course display a genuine willingness to help, show drive and initiative, and bring a positive 'can-do' attitude. If this sounds like you, we want you on the team!

Additionally, volunteers applying to join this program will be required to supply to following documentation:

  • Emergency contact
  • Passport
  • Recommendation letter from your college or Church

Program Fees
At Mission Trips Uganda, we try to make the cost of our trips as reasonable as possible. If this trip is Gods will then He will provide you with the necessary funding.

Administration Fee $250; This is due to the Uganda office two weeks after your application is accepted and approved.

In addition to the administration fee, there is a mission fee payable to Mission Trips Uganda based on the length of time you plan to serve:

Length of Trip Mission Fee
1 week $725

10 days 2 weeks $950

3 weeks $1,200
4 weeks $1,400
5 weeks $1,600
6 weeks $1,800
7 weeks $2,000
8 weeks $2,200
3-4 months $900/month
5 months+ $800/month

Mission fees are due to the Uganda office at least 35 days prior to arrival in Africa.

Please note the if your stay is a few days after a week long interval, but doesnt make a full extra week of stay the fee is $75 per day. For example, if you sign up for a 2 week trip and your scheduled arrival and departure in country is actually 2 weeks and 2 days the additional fee would be $150 for the 2 additional days.

Mission Trip Offered By Mission Trips Uganda

Mission Trips Uganda is non-profit organization based in Uganda, East-Africa that focuses on children and families living in extreme poverty in by re-building communities and empowering today’s Children and youth. Mission Trips Uganda rescues vulnerable children and places them in loving families. Our goal is not only to meet their physical needs, but to give them everything they need to become healthy and whole, and live a life of purpose. We focus on providing food, clothing, medical care, education and a safe place they can call home. We give children support and the holistic care in their families that every person needs to thrive.
